在WordPress中,可以通过以下几种方式来确定当前用户的作用:
$current_user
,它包含了当前用户的所有信息。可以通过访问$current_user->roles
属性来获取当前用户的角色列表。角色是WordPress中用于控制用户权限的机制,不同的角色具有不同的权限。例如,管理员角色具有最高权限,而订阅者角色只能浏览网站内容。current_user_can()
函数来检查当前用户是否具有特定的权限。该函数接受一个参数,用于指定要检查的权限。如果当前用户具有该权限,则返回true
,否则返回false
。current_user_can()
函数结合钩子函数来检查当前用户的权限,并根据需要执行相应的操作。例如,可以使用admin_init
钩子来在后台管理界面加载时检查当前用户是否具有管理员权限。总结起来,要确定当前用户在WordPress中的作用,可以使用全局变量、条件语句、钩子函数和插件等方式来获取和管理当前用户的信息和权限。根据具体需求,可以选择适合的方法来实现相应的功能。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云